What is Definition?

 

Ironically, the definition of the term “definition essay” is not very specific.  Definition essays are short pieces of writing on a particular topic.  However, not every essay on a topic can be properly labeled a definition essay.  Instead, a definition essay is an attempt to describe the topic thoroughly enough for the reader to understand it very well and might be compared to an encyclopedia entry for the topic.  Any of our example essays could provide a good start on a definition essay about the topic.  However, we have collected a sample of our best definition essays and included them below to help you explore the genre.
